Output 656823886158764b4f0bb1307a49c94f97da52a23f33a41a91d5e28c4035be77:2
- value
- 26013192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bda3ac92ab135992f69ab8a8324667940ce858f4 OP_EQUAL
- address
- 3Jyji5PQV119Bzw6N4DRE24ZEKHSjQgwJR
- transaction
- 656823886158764b4f0bb1307a49c94f97da52a23f33a41a91d5e28c4035be77
- confirmations
- 384954
- spent
- true